Excel 如何计算入职天数?如何快速统计员工服务时长?
作者:佚名|分类:EXCEL|浏览:93|发布时间:2025-04-13 07:07:31
Excel 如何计算入职天数?如何快速统计员工服务时长?
在企业管理中,员工的服务时长和入职天数是重要的数据,它们对于员工的绩效评估、薪酬计算以及人力资源规划都有着至关重要的作用。在Excel中,我们可以通过简单的函数和公式来计算这些数据。以下将详细介绍如何在Excel中计算入职天数和快速统计员工服务时长。
一、计算入职天数
要计算员工入职天数,我们需要知道员工的入职日期和当前日期。以下是具体的步骤:
1. 设置日期格式:确保Excel中的日期格式正确,否则计算结果可能会出错。
2. 输入员工入职日期:在Excel表格中,为每位员工输入其入职日期。
3. 计算入职天数:
在一个单独的单元格中,输入公式 `=TODAY()` 来获取当前日期。
在另一个单元格中,输入公式 `=TODAY() 入职日期单元格`。例如,如果员工的入职日期在B2单元格,则公式为 `=TODAY() B2`。
按下回车键,即可得到员工入职的天数。
二、快速统计员工服务时长
统计员工服务时长通常需要将所有员工的服务时长加总。以下是具体的步骤:
1. 输入员工服务时长:在Excel表格中,为每位员工输入其服务时长,单位可以是月、年或天数。
2. 计算总服务时长:
在一个单独的单元格中,输入公式 `=SUM(服务时长单元格区域)`。例如,如果员工的服务时长在C2:C10单元格区域,则公式为 `=SUM(C2:C10)`。
按下回车键,即可得到所有员工的总服务时长。
三、注意事项
1. 日期格式:确保所有日期格式一致,否则计算结果可能不准确。
2. 单元格引用:在计算公式中,正确引用单元格,避免出现错误。
3. 数据更新:定期更新员工的服务时长和入职日期,以确保数据的准确性。
四、实例
假设我们有一个员工信息表,包含员工姓名、入职日期和服务时长。以下是表格的示例:
| 员工姓名 | 入职日期 | 服务时长(月) |
|---------|---------|--------------|
| 张三 | 2020/1/1 | 24 |
| 李四 | 2019/5/15| 18 |
| 王五 | 2021/9/10| 12 |
根据上述步骤,我们可以计算出每位员工的入职天数和总服务时长。
相关问答
1. 如何处理跨年的入职日期?
答: 跨年的入职日期不会影响计算结果。Excel会自动处理日期差,包括跨年的情况。
2. 如果员工的服务时长不是整数月,如何计算?
答: 如果服务时长不是整数月,可以直接输入小数。例如,如果员工服务了2年零3个月,可以输入2.25。
3. 如何将服务时长转换为天数?
答: 如果服务时长是以月为单位,可以将其乘以30来转换为天数。例如,如果员工服务了2.5年,则服务天数为 `2.5 * 12 * 30 = 900` 天。
4. 如何处理员工离职的情况?
答: 当员工离职时,可以在服务时长单元格中输入0,或者在计算总服务时长时排除该员工的数据。
通过以上步骤和注意事项,相信您已经能够在Excel中轻松计算入职天数和统计员工服务时长。这些数据对于企业的人力资源管理至关重要,希望本文能对您有所帮助。